To make this card I cut a piece of copy paper just bigger than my Whisper White mat and then cut a circle at the top middle. Remove & discard the circle cut out.
Using the remaining rectangle as a mask, I sponged the circle with Smoky Slate, Rich Razzleberry & Night of Navy inks. I then stamped the filigree reindeer in Versamark and heat embossed in silver.
The sentiment was stamped with the help of my Stamparatus in Rich Razzleberry.
The Rich Razzleberry card base was embossed using the Tin Tile embossing folder and the reindeer panel mounted on Smoky Slate then adhered to the card base using dimensionals.
